Best Christmas Gift: Bawumia reunites with 4-year-old cured leper he sponsored for treatment
Vice President Dr Mahamudu Bawumia has described his reunion with Priscilla, a four-year-old cured leper from the Weija Leprosarium, as his "best Christmas gift."
Dr Bawumia took to Facebook to share the emotional encounter, recounting how Priscilla, whom he had sponsored for medical treatment in Italy, visited him at his home to express her gratitude and showcase her remarkable recovery.
“I got my best Christmas gift yesterday when Priscilla, a four-year-old cured leper from the Weija leprosarium whom I sponsored for medical treatment of her amputated leg in Italy, returned to Ghana and paid me a visit at home to thank me and show that she can now walk with her new leg. To God be the glory,” the Vice President wrote.
Priscilla, who underwent treatment for her amputated leg, now walks confidently with the aid of a prosthetic leg, a visible testament to her resilience and the life-changing support she received.
